Living in the "Heart of Dixie" is a 'Good Thing' when you can drive a couple of hours northward into Tennessee and catch some really nice Trout . My half-brother in Tenn. sent me a Tenn. fishing guide in 2010 and on the cover was a huge Brookie . The last time I caught one was in 1965 when I was a kid . Tennessee is stocking Brookies and doing a great job of it . On the Clinch and the Caney Fork Rivers there regulations for the protection of this fish in the 14 to twenty inch length, I would soil my britches for one of 12 inches !
